Paweł Zieliński, born on July 17, 1990, in Ząbkowice Śląskie, Poland, is a professional footballer who operates primarily as a defender. Standing at 1.78 meters (5 feet 10 inches), Zieliński has built a career characterized by his defensive resilience and versatility across the backline. His professional journey has largely unfolded within the Polish football landscape, where he has become a familiar figure in various league competitions. Club Tenures

Zieliński's senior career commenced in the early 2010s. One of his notable early spells was with Śląsk Wrocław, a prominent club in Poland. According to Transfermarkt, Paweł Zieliński joined Śląsk Wrocław in 2011, initially integrating into their setup. He spent several seasons there, gaining experience in various competitions including the Ekstraklasa, Poland's top flight. This period was crucial for his development, as he solidified his position as a reliable defender.

Following his time at Śląsk Wrocław, Zieliński moved to Górnik Zabrze, another historically significant club in Polish football. His transfer to Górnik Zabrze, as documented by Wikipedia's entry on Paweł Zieliński, provided him with further opportunities to demonstrate his defensive capabilities at a high level. During his tenure at Górnik Zabrze, he continued to be a regular starter, contributing to the team's efforts in league campaigns. Club Honours

Throughout his time in Polish football, Zieliński has been part of teams that have achieved success in domestic competitions. His tenure with clubs such as Śląsk Wrocław and Górnik Zabrze has included participation in the Ekstraklasa, the top tier of Polish football, and cup competitions.

A significant highlight of his career includes his involvement with Śląsk Wrocław during a period of competitive success. The club secured the Ekstraklasa title in the 2011–12 season, a testament to the team's collective effort and Zieliński's contribution as part of the squad. This championship win represents a major achievement in his club career.
